The overall intake for the general BSc programme at Vimala College is 55 seats.
The seats varied for various BSc subjects:

  • 50 places for the BSc in Mathematics
  • 33 places for BSc Physics
  •  BSc  in Chemistry - 36 spots
  •  Botany in BSc: 25 places
  • Zoology in BSc: 25 seats
  •  Home Science BSc (20 places).

Fifty percent of the seats in each programme are set aside for students from the community that owns and operates the college.

Using the normal admissions procedure, the remaining 50% of the seats are filled on the basis of merit.

Vimala College has affordable fee strcture. The fee strcture of the UG and PG programme ranges between INR 3.87 K- INR 1.01 lakh. The fees includes several components, such as caution deposit, exam fee, tuition fee, and more. Applicants also need to pay a one-time fee during the admission process. The fee payment can be completed via mode of payment specified by the institute.
